The record shows that Ms. Harriman had been sanctioned for failure to comply with discovery requests and orders several times prior to the September 8 hearing. On June 7, 2005, the trial court granted a motion for sanctions due to Ms. Harriman's failure to respond to Mr. Harriman's request for production, and her failure to appear for deposition on three different occasions. On September 15, 2005, the trial court entered its second sanctions order, again ordering Ms. Harriman to appear for deposition, and ordering her to pay $1,200 in attorney's fees and costs to Mr. Harriman's attorney. The following January, the trial court entered an additional order regarding Ms. Harriman's response to Mr. Harriman's request for production, specifically ordering her to reorganize her production response so that the documents corresponded to Mr. Harriman's request. The court also ordered Ms. Harriman to produce the children's medical records and contact information for health care providers as requested by Mr. Harriman. Finally, during the September 8 hearing, the trial court specifically inquired whether Ms. Harriman had any evidence to support her assertion that delivery was refused by Mr. Harriman's attorney. She was not able to do so. Her argument was refuted by Mr. Harriman's attorney, who represented to the court that delivery was never attempted, and would not have been refused by his office. We are told that the respondent initially appointed Mid-Missouri Legal Services to represent the plaintiff, but was informed that the "charter" of that organization precluded its handling of "fee generating" cases, which a claim for damages for malpractice presumably is. These assertions do not wholly satisfy me. Some legal services offices assume representation of an indigent, even in damage suits, if it is demonstrated that private lawyers are not willing to handle the case. The respondent might also explore the possibility of appointing one or more of the individual lawyers of the legal services organization. Their employer's time is no more sacred than that of a private practitioner. A lawyer won $54,000, in Florida for a 21 college student with nerve injury after wisdom tooth surgery. 5 Attorneys representing injured patients against doctors and hospitals are seldom paid by the hour because their clients could not afford that kind of fee. The average hourly rate (over $ 250) and the average number of total hours (over 500-1000) required for such cases by an attorney would make the fee so large that few would be able to pay it. Instead, almost all medical malpractice attorneys are paid by way of contingency fees. Under a contingency fee, the attorney is paid no fee for his time and effort in a case unless and until the attorney recovers money or some other value for the patient by way of settlement or judgment. A contingency fee is usually a percentage (agreed upon in advance) of the settlement or judgment.
Introduction: This article presents the outcome and recommendations following the second stage of a role development project conducted on behalf of the New Zealand Institute of Medical Radiation Technology (NZIMRT). The study sought to support the development of profiles and criteria that may be used to formulate Advanced Scopes of Practice for the profession. It commenced in 2011, following on from initial research that occurred between 2005 and 2008 investigating role development and a possible career structure for medical radiation technologists (MRTs) in New Zealand (NZ). Methods: The study sought to support the development of profiles and criteria that could be used to develop Advanced Scopes of Practice for the profession through inviting 12 specialist medical imaging groups in NZ to participate in a survey. Results: Findings showed strong agreement on potential profiles and on generic criteria within them; however, there was less agreement on specific skills criteria within specialist areas. Conclusions: The authors recommend that one Advanced Scope of Practice be developed for Medical Imaging, with the establishment of generic and specialist criteria. Systems for approval of the overall criteria package for any individual Advanced Practitioner (AP) profile, audit and continuing professional development requirements need to be established by the Medical Radiation Technologists Board (MRTB) to meet the local needs of clinical departments. It is further recommended that the NZIMRT and MRTB promote and support the need for an AP pathway for medical imaging in NZ. Both Texas and Florida have historically operated under a failed enforcement model of pay and chase.25,26 Medicaid payments are made to providers (or their corporate beneficial owners, usually DSOs) year after year without question or examination. If an audit is eventually generated, it then becomes a massive records undertaking. Government regulators usually lack funds to retain meaningful dentist auditors, to thoroughly review patient records and billings. Behind the 8-ball, government prosecutors nearly always settle cases for pennies on the dollar, and no admission of wrong-doing by violators. Although there have been a handful of studies examining the work of chaplains and prison volunteers in a Western setting, few have endeavored to conduct research into the experiences of religious workers in Asian penitentiaries. To fill this gap, this article reports on exploratory research examining the work of a selected group of religious workers in Hong Kong prisons. A total of 17 religious workers were interviewed: 10 prison chaplains and 7 Buddhist volunteers who paid regular prison visits. Qualitative findings generated from in-depth interviews present three themes: the range of religious activities performed, the importance of religion for the rehabilitation of inmates, and the hope of continued religious support to prisoners after discharge. The significance of this research is that it sheds light on the understudied work of prison chaplains and volunteers in Hong Kong and portrays the difference between the works of the Christian ministry and Buddhist volunteers. The Robinsons argue that the law is special because Crown Cork lobbied for the act and that at least one legislator called the Act the Crown Cork issue in a committee hearing. This evidence is also unavailing. First, as a beneficiary of this law, Crown Cork would certainly lobby for its enactment. But then again, public interest groups, individuals, and businesses regularly lobby for legislation that affects them directly or as an industry, and lobbyists regularly draft legislation for legislators. See, e.g., Victoria F. Nourse & Jane S. Schacter, The Politics of Legislative Drafting: A Congressional Case Study, 77 N.Y.U. L. Rev. 575, 583, 587, 591 (2002) (noting a number of responses by legislative aides that lobbyists regularly draft the text of bills debated in the Senate Judiciary Committee and discussing an account by a legislative aide where a companion bill was negotiated and drafted by lobbyists and introduced with only minor changes ). Many involved in the sausage making 20 task of developing law use lobbyists to draft the text of bills because lobbyists provide valuable information and perspective on the bills being introduced. Id. at 583. Cognizant as I am of the need to avoid the gifts given by the Legislature to favored individuals, the Robinsons must come up with more evidence than the mere fact that Crown Cork was involved in the passing, or even the drafting, of the act in question.
